Besibellabath/Sambhar rice


This mixed rice is something I dread when I was a little child. It was really spicy then.

Now I love to have a big serving of it in one sitting..such a yummy fab delicious dish…with lotsa of veggies in it…nice and glossy…

Ingredients:

1. Vegetables – Drumstick, brinjal, carrot, cauliflower, potato, long beans, green peas (1 of each)
2. finely chopped onions - 2
3. finely chopped tomatoes – 2
4. Soaked rice – 2 cup
5. Sambhar paruppu – 1 cup
6. Asafodiea powder – ½ tbsp
7. malli (coriander ) seeds – 1 tbsp
8. jeerakham seeds – 1 tbsp
9. dry red chilli – 1-2
10. turmeric powder – a pinch
11. salt to taste
12. 1 handful of grated coconut/coppara

Method of preparation:

1. Soak the rice and sambhar paruppu (already washed) in 7 cup of water for 10-15 mintues
2. in a kadai, fry deeply the grated coconut/coppara, coriander seeds,red dry chilli, jeerakham seeds, Asafodiea powder, 1-2 pearl onions, 1 strand of curry leaves with little oil.
3. Grind the above mix and keep it aside
4. in a deep bottom kadai, pour some oil and fry the chopped vegetables mentioned above with little salt and pinch of turmeric powder.
5. Add the ground paste to the above fried vegetables and just cook for 5 minutes
6. Now in a pressure cooker, mix the soaked rice and sambhar paruppu with the water to the above mix and cook it till 3 whistles.

It should come out like a nice, over cooked rice….something like sticky sticky consistency.


Mix the whole stuff well and garnish with chopped coriander leaves. Adjust the salt after tasting it.

Kariveppalla/Curry leaf chutney

Ingredients:

• 1 /2 tbsp of mustard seeds
• cooking oil – 1 tbsp
• 1 tbsp – uzhundhu dhal seeds
• 1 tbsp – kadala paruppu
• salt to taste
• 1 small piece of tamarind
• Handful of curry leaves
• 1 – finely chopped onion
• 1- finely chopped tomatoes
• 1-2 green chillies slited
• 1-2 dry red chilli

Method of preparation:

• In a heavy bottom pan, pour out some cooking oil and throw all the above ingredients and fry it till it becomes dry.
• Grind it very well with little water.

For seasoning:
• In a pan, heat little cooking oil and splutter the mustard seeds and dry broken red chilli

Pour out the seasoning to the above ground curry leaf paste and mix it well.



Enjoy this with hot hot idli, dosa...

If you mix it with plain rice, it becomes the kariveppalla rice..(another mixed rice)...

Mixed vegetable fried rice - A fusion

Ingredients:
1. 1 chopped carrot
2. 2 chopped onions
3. few beans
4. ginger and garlic - small pieces
5. somphu, cloves, cinnamon, bay leaves, badam – few of each
6. turmeric powder – ½ tbsp
7. chilli powder – ½ tbsp
8. garam masala powder – 1 tbsp
9. cooking oil - 1 tbsp
10. soaked 1 cup of rice for ½ hour

Method of preparation:

In a heavy bottom kadai, heat 1-2 tbsp of cooking oil and splutter some somphu seeds. After that add cloves, cinnamon, bay leaves, badam and fry it till fragrant.
Add chopped ginger pieces and garlic pieces/ ginger garlic paste and sauté till the raw smell leaves.
Add all the chopped onions and fry it till it becomes brown color.
Add all the chopped veggies to it and sauté it.
Add chilli powder/gram masala powder and lotsa of curry leaves and turmeric powder and salt to taste and mix it well and allow it to cook for sometime.
Now add the soaked rice with 2 glass of water and mix the whole contents well and pressure cook it till 3 whistles.



Garnish it with coriander leaves (if available)…

Tomato rice


How to make tomato rice:

Ingredients:

1 tbsp cooking oil
1 tbsp mustard seeds
few urud dhal seeds
few kadala paruppu seeds
1/2 tbsp ginger garlic paste
1 tbsp chilli powder
1 tbsp garam masala powder
salt to taste
4-5 ripe tomatoes chopped
1-2 onions
coriander leaves
curry leaves
jeeram seeds

soaked rice - 2 cups (1/2 hour)


Method of preparation:

In a kadai, heat 1 tbsp of cooking oil and splutter some mustard seeds, add cloves, cinnamon, bay leaves and sauté it till fragrant. Add the ginger garlic paste to this and sauté it till the raw smell leaves. Add chopped onions, curry leaves and salt to taste and let it get fried till light golden brown.
Add chopped tomatoes to this and let it cook till it becomes soggy and fragrant. Add 1 tbsp of chilli powder, turmeric powder, garam masala and mix it well.
Garnish it with corriander leaves. Then add the 2 cup of soaked rice to this and 4 cup of water and mix it well and pressure cook it till 3 whistles.

Mixed vegetable rice


When i came back from office, i found that the rice which had been cooked for lunch remained untouched. I decided to make a quick vegetable rice. This is one way by which i can forcefully make my children eat all the veggie's...

I used microwave for this.

Here is how i made:

Ingredients
1. 2 chopped carrot
2. 2 chopped onions
3. few beans
4. 1 chopped potatoes
5. 1 chopped capisicum
6. ginger and garlic - small pieces
7. somphu, cloves, cinnamon, bay leaves - little
8. cooking oil - 1 tbsp

Method of preparation:

1. Steam the already cooked rice with a pressure cooker/ outside to make it hot.

2. In a microwave safe bowl, pour some oil and put the onions, somphu, cloves, cinnamon, bay leaves and cook it for 2 - 3 minutes. stir the contents in between.

3. Added the chopped vegetables, salt to taste, 1/2 tbsp of gram masala powder. Mix it well and cook for 6-7 minutes.

4. I transferred the whole content to a mudpot and also added the already warmed rice to it and mix the whole content and cook for another 5-6 minutes.


It came out very well. It looked colorful and tasted yum...

Mango rice




How to make mango rice mix:

The mango story contines….
I grated the mangoes into small pieces and cooked it with little water, with 1 tbsp of salt, 1 tbsp of chilly powder and turmeric powder. When it is done, I seasoned it by heating 1 tbsp oil in a kadai, add 1 tbsp mustard seed, 1 tbsp of urudh seeds, 1 tbsp of kadala paruppu, some jeerakham, 1 - 2 red dry chillies, 1-2 green chillies, 1 handful of groundnut, and lots of curry leaves.

Mix the above prepared mix to the rice and serve it with pappad/pickle.

Lemon Rice - A Yellow Rice



Here is how I prepare Lemon Rice…..My son’s favorite , the yellow rice……
To make Lemon Rice :

Take 2 cup of already cooked rice. To it , add salt to taste and lemon juice of 2 lemon. Mix it thoroughly and keep it aside.

Chop 2 onions and slit 2 green chilies, 2-3 broken dry red chillies, some curry leaves for seasoning. Can also add some groundnut and pottu (chutney) kadalai.

Heat 1 tbsp oil in a kadai, splutter 1 tbsp mustard seed, 1 tbsp of urudh seed, 1 tbsp of kadala paruppu (Channa Dhal seeds). Sim the burner so that these seeds do not get charred. When the seeds change the color to light brown, add 2 onions chopped and saute it until they are slightly golden and soft. Add lots of curry leaves. Then add groundnut and pottu (chutney) kadalai and saute it till it is fried to golden brown.

Then add the rice to the above mix, and mix it well thoroughly (sim the burner).


Lemon Rice is ready!!!!!
